The Corporation of the City of Brockville invites applications from qualified and interested candidates for a part time Arena Facility Operator (certified) position in the Facilities and Arenas Division within the Operations Department.

This position provides support by completing routine tasks at the Brockville Youth Arena and the Brockville Memorial Centre during the yearly operation.  Duties include but are not limited to performing ice maintenance activities, performing and logging inspections, janitorial and cleaning, rental hall set up and take down, customer service, and facility maintenance.
